In the old days, there was one balance knob we used that didn't have the traditional loss in the middle. Ibanez made a dual 500K blend pot that worked perfectly. We were able to buy them as spare parts back then, and use them in Bartolini setups. I don't know if they're still available. You guys seem really up on recent events. If it still exists, it would be worth knowing about.
